We told you 13 years ago to fill the empty space in your freezer w...Ok, If the outside of the unit is hot then you either have clogged condenser coils or a bad condenser fan. If your unit is not hot on the outside and it still doesn't cool then check to make sure that your evaporator coils are clear from ice. The evaporator coils are located behind the back panel in the freezer portion of the fridge. Dirty condenser coils can cause cooling problems in the freezer. Unplug the refrigerator and check the condenser coils for dust and dirt buildup. Clean the condenser coils if they're dirty. Continue to clean the coils when you perform routine refrigerator maintenance. The damper is a small flap that controls the flow of air from the freezer to the refrigerator. It is usually found in the top of the fridge or on the back panel near the top. The damper is controlled by a thermostat, which triggers it to open and close depending on the temperature of the air in the refrigerator.02 - Condenser Fan Motor. The condenser fan motor draws air though the condenser coils and over the compressor. If the condenser fan motor is not working properly, the refrigerator won’t cool properly. To determine if the fan motor is defective, first check the fan blade for obstructions. Next, try turning the fan motor blade by hand.

To determine if the fan motor is defective, first check the fan blade for obstructions.Unplug the refrigerator and check the freezer temperature sensor wiring connected to the control board for damage. Repair any broken wires. Measure the resistance through the freezer temperature sensor circuit from the control board. Kenmore Refrigerator Freezer Not Cold. One of the most common causes for a Kenmore freezer not being cold is a broken compressor, which I will explain in the next section. Otherwise, other common causes include the following. An air leak. The evaporator coils are covered in frost. Dirty condenser coils.
